Position Summary

Manage, plan, direct and coordinate a wide range of departmental and city program activities in support of Human Resources administration and general operations of the department; resolve management and administrative issues; perform a variety of professional tasks relative to assigned areas of responsibility. Act as an internal consultant and advisor to all levels of management, supervisors and or staff by understanding goals, issues and needs regarding appropriate Human Resources services and solutions. Provide highly responsible and complex assistance to Director of Human Resources.

Minimum Education, Experience And Additional Requirements

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in Human Resources, Public Administration, or Business Management preferred;

and

Nine (9) years of professional Human Resources Management or related experience preferred;

and

To include

six (6) years of supervisory experience preferred.

ADDITIONAL REQUIREMENTS:

Possession of a valid New Mexico Driver's License, or the ability to obtain by date of hire.
Possession of a City Operator's Permit (COP) within six (6) months from date of hire.
